    This is the go to spot when buying cigarettes. Me and my wife just left the casino, I needed gas and she needed to re-up on her special brand of yellow American spirits. I know you smokers are more dedicated to your brand of cigarettes then anything else in this society. When she saw how cheap the prices are for a carton of those smooth yellow boxed American spirits. She bought all they had. Yes, it was only 2 cartons left but she said she didn't mind if there was 20 left. She was going to buy them all. Now I'm not sure if they don't charge tax or we got a discount on top of the full price but we walked out of there super excited. I honestly don't think we can beat the prices anywhere near here. Definitely not in san diego where we are originally from. I did the math and she paid about $9.00 a pack where in san diego she's paid up to $15.00 a pack in some places. My advice is to go here for your nicotine addiction. Oh and it's actually really close to the freeway so there's easy access.

    Best Diesel Fuel Price In All Of Phoenix Area! While checking my gas buddy app for the cheapest diesel fuel since I need 130 gallons at a time I found this place I had never seen before. Fuel was only $2.77 a gallon here while it was $2.89-2.99 everywhere else. So off I journey to save my $20 on my fuel for the day. Friendly staff in a super clean newer gas station next to the casino. Really nice gas station!

    I don't often drive across the Valley for a tobacco shop, but after battling the Loop 101 and…read morefinally pulling into Stag Tobacconist in Scottsdale, I immediately understood why people make the trip. The storefront practically says, "Congratulations, you've found the place." And it is - THE PLACE. Whether you're into cigars, pipes, or pipe tobacco, Stag appears to have just about everything you could need. The selection is impressive, but what really sets this place apart is the knowledge behind the counter. I immediately met Rick, the curator and a true tobacconist. He was a little intimidating at first, but within a few minutes I realized I was talking to someone with a lifetime of experience and absolutely no interest in selling me something I didn't need. This week marked 50 years of pipe smoking for him. I explained that I was a longtime cigar smoker just beginning my pipe journey. As I started comparing my cigar preferences to pipe tobacco, he stopped me and said something along the lines of, "Pipes and cigars are apples and oranges." That turned out to be the most valuable lesson of the day. I handed him my shopping list: * Bristle pipe cleaners * A quality pipe pouch * Pipe tobacco He immediately started making recommendations. He put Capstan Blue, Three Nuns ("Three Penguins," according to Rick), and Peterson Nightcap in my hands. They were out of Peterson Deluxe Navy Rolls, and when I asked about their house Burley, he told me it wasn't worth my time. I appreciated the honesty. Then came the conversation that made the trip worthwhile. As I was preparing to check out, Rick asked how many pipes I owned. When I told him, he launched into a discussion about what he calls "ghost smokers"--new pipe enthusiasts who constantly chase the next blend, never spend enough time with one tobacco to really understand it, and never allow a pipe or blend to develop its own character. He explained that tobacco needs time to tell its story, and that dedicating certain pipes to certain blends allows both the pipe and the smoker to develop a deeper appreciation for them. It wasn't a sales pitch. In fact, he talked me out of buying several things I originally planned to purchase. I ultimately left with two tins of Three Nuns, a tin of Cornell & Diehl Burley Flake #5 (which Rick insisted I needed to try), a quality pipe pouch, cleaning supplies, and a beautifully restored estate pipe for $50ish that seemed far too nice for the price. More importantly, I left with a better understanding of pipe smoking than I had when I walked in. That's the difference between a store and a tobacconist. If you're looking for someone to ring up a sale, there are plenty of places that can do that. If you're looking for experience, wisdom, honest recommendations, and people who genuinely care about the hobby, Stag Tobacconist is absolutely worth the drive. I'll be back.
